GNSS-processing software

Practical GNSS-processing software training covering data structure, transfer, naming, validation, coordinate references, processing choices, and retention of original observations.

Overview

This course develops GNSS-processing software capability through guided explanation and hands-on work. Participants focus on moving sample data through an organized processing sequence and checking the resulting files or coordinates. The programme is adjusted to participant experience, available equipment or software, and the intended application; no formal accreditation or certification is claimed.
